Good news for the unemployed: Rajasthan government will soon recruit 3500 new CHOs; 4 months ago was given appointment to 7810 CHO

Jaipur an hour ago

The Rajasthan government is preparing to make a new recruitment of 3500 CHO (Community Health Officer) soon. About four months ago, the government had appointed 7810 CHOs after completing the recruitment process, whose training would also be started from this month. All these recruitments were done on contract basis.

Medical Minister Dr. Raghu Sharma held a review meeting with medical and health officers late in the evening, in which it was informed that the training of all these 7810 CHOs would start from September 7. Apart from this, keeping in mind the medical needs of the state, the recruitment process of 3500 additional CHOs will also be started soon.

Camp will start from November 14

Former Prime Minister Medical camps will be organized on a large scale across the state from November 14 on the birth anniversary of Pt. Jawaharlal Nehru. In these camps, arrangements will be made for the treatment of patients suffering from post-covid diseases and all other diseases. Apart from having facilities for screening and testing of diseases, all types of vaccines will also be provided in these camps. If needed, arrangements will be made to send serious patients to nearby big hospitals through ambulances for necessary treatment. The officials of the Medical and Health Department have been instructed to start preparations for these camps. This camp will run for about a month.

100 public clinics will also start

The Medical Minister announced to start about two dozen Janata clinics in the state on the day of Gandhi Jayanti. Apart from this, he also talked about opening 100 new Janta Clinics in this budget session. For this, instructions have been given to find the place as soon as possible where the public clinic is to be opened.
